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-51988

Course participation report - does not check that messaging is disabled

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Minor
    • Resolution: Fixed
    • Affects Version/s: 2.8.6, 2.9, 2.9.3
    • Fix Version/s: 2.9.4, 3.0.1
    • Component/s: Messages, Reports
    • Labels:
    • Testing Instructions:
      Hide
      1. Go to a course with some enrolled students and login as a teacher.
      2. Select Reports > Course Participation and show a report for an activity
      3. VERIFY: that you can see options to message students
      4. Disable messaging in site settings
      5. VERIFY: that you can no longer message students
      Show
      Go to a course with some enrolled students and login as a teacher. Select Reports > Course Participation and show a report for an activity VERIFY: that you can see options to message students Disable messaging in site settings VERIFY: that you can no longer message students
    • Affected Branches:
      MOODLE_28_STABLE, MOODLE_29_STABLE
    • Fixed Branches:
      MOODLE_29_STABLE, MOODLE_30_STABLE
    • Pull Master Branch:
      MDL-51988-master

      Description

      In the course participation report there is an option to select students to message. This is still available when messaging is switched off on the site. Can the report check whether messaging is enabled, so that the option to send a message is not displayed when messaging is not active.

      To replicate -

      • Switch off messaging in administration
      • Go to a course and login as a teacher.
      • Select Reports > Course Participation and show a report for a feature.
      • Select a students to message
      • Says - Messaging is disabled on this site.

        Attachments

          Issue Links

            Activity

              People

              • Votes:
                1 Vote for this issue
                Watchers:
                5 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ved:
                  Fix Release Date:
                  21/Dec/15